4 wanted in nonprofit scam

1 suspect arrested

JACKSONVILLE, Fla. – The Jacksonville Sheriff's Office named four suspects who they say scammed a nonprofit organization out of thousands of dollars.

Police said Sauna Hicks and Johnny McCray, two employees at the Community Rehabilitation Center, stole more than $77,000 during a nine month period.

Hicks was arrested on Thursday.

McCray was a pastor who used the personal information of his church members to create checks in their name without their knowledge, police said. He turned himself in Friday afternoon.

Police are also looking for Robyn Melton, Cynthia Harris and Phyllis Ray, who they said received the stolen funds.
